I have had a credit card under my name that is shared between my sisters and I for the last year and a half. This card is automatically payed off by my parents, as it is only used for essentials (food, clothes, etc). It has never gone above 30% usage and has always been paid off on time. I now have about a 760 credit score according to creditkarma.

I have been told that I should also open a credit card under my own name to start building trust, since eventually the card under my parents' account will removed.

How do I apply for a card when my only source of income is my parents? I tried applying for one with chase but was denied since it was over the internet and I wasn't able to explain that I have the money available to pay it off (despite not having income).

What do I do? Should I go in and try to apply in person to explain this detail with one of my parents?
